Abstract

The utility model relates to a circuit monitoring technology field particularly, relates to a distribution box. Include: the distribution box main part, still be provided with on off state induction system, controller, the input output module of electricity connection in proper order in the distribution box main part, on off state induction system is used for generating influence electricity signal according to the state of the switch of installing in the distribution box main part, on off state induction system and the separation of switch physics, the controller is used for judging the on off state of switch according to the influence electricity signal, generates the on off state signal of telecommunication, input output module is used for the output switch state signal of telecommunication, still be provided with power module in the distribution box main part, power module still is connected with the wireless receiving module of charging, and the wireless receiving module of charging still cooperates the wireless module of charging that has rather than the physics separation. Distribution box passes through the position of on off state induction system monitoring switch, can realize the monitoring to the circuit operation conditions under the condition of not going on reforming transform to current circuit, and simultaneously, it is higher to get electrical safety nature.

Shown in Figure 4, in this utility model, also provide for a kind of on off state sensing dress The specific implementation put, the switch status induction system that this utility model embodiment is provided Including: proximity transducer 80;Described proximity transducer 80 is arranged on described switch 50 panel Oblique upper or obliquely downward, and described switch 50 and described proximity transducer can be monitored Distance between 80.
Implementing when, proximity transducer 80 is that instead of the contacts such as limit switch Detection mode, to carry out being detected as the general name of the sensor of purpose without contact detection object. Can be by the detection mobile message of object with there is information and be converted to electric signal.It is being changed to electrically In the detection mode of signal, including in the metallic object of the detection object utilizing electromagnetic induction to cause The mode of the vortex flow produced, catch survey body close to the volume change of electric signal caused The mode of mode, Magnetitum and directing switch.
As a example by chopper, proximity transducer 80 is typically fixed on chopper and is provided with The side of switch 50.Proximity transducer 80 can be directly anchored on chopper (but disconnected Switch 50 on the device of road and proximity transducer 80 physical separation), it is also possible to it is fixed on In distribution box main body 10.It is provided with up and down switch 50 on chopper, and breaks The mounting means that road device is general is: when switch 50 is in top when, breaker closing, When switch 50 is below when, chopper disconnects.
Therefore, chopper is arranged on different positions, the on off state of indicated chopper It is different.Such as when proximity transducer 80 is arranged on the oblique upper of switch 50 when, When the switch distance that proximity transducer 80 is sensed is closer to therewith, chopper is in Closure state, and the switch 50 that proximity transducer 80 senses apart from therewith further from time, Chopper is off;When proximity transducer 80 is arranged on switch 50 obliquely downward Wait, be then arranged on the situation contrast of switch 50 oblique uppers with it.Although in different peaces In the case of dress, proximity transducer 80 all can be according to the switch 50 of chopper and described close biography The distance of sensor 80 generates electrical signal of reaction, and works as what it was generated by proximity transducer 80 After electrical signal of reaction passes to described controller, controller can judge according to this electrical signal of reaction The on off state of chopper, generates the corresponding on off state signal of telecommunication.

Implementing when, NFC sensor label 100 is provided in switching on 50; NFC induction installation 90 is then and the setting switching 50 physical separation, is positioned at switch panel Oblique upper or obliquely downward.Or as a example by chopper, generally, due to chopper Switch has generally comprised two states, i.e. on and off, and under the two state, Switch towards being different.NFC sensor label 100 is arranged on switch, NFC The position of sensor label 100 can change along with the change in location of switch.And NFC is sensed Device 90 is arranged on only switch 50 and is in some state and can sense that NFC senses The position of label 100, then when change occurs in the on off state of chopper when, NFC Sensor label 100 can be changed to non-readable state from the state of can read, or from unreadable The state of taking is changed to can read state, thus NFC induction installation 90 can be according to reading knot Fruit generates corresponding electrical signal of reaction.It should be noted that just meeting when only read When having reading result, NFC induction installation 90 just can generate electrical signal of reaction.
Usually, chopper is installing when, the when that usually switch being allocated to top, Closing of power circuit breaker, and the when that switch being allocated to lower section, chopper disconnects.NFC can be felt Answer device that switch panel oblique upper or the obliquely downward of chopper are set so that NFC senses dress Put the induction range of 90 and be positioned at the either above or below of switch.
When NFC induction installation 90 is above when, the when of switch conduction, NFC Sensor label 100 is pushed top together along with switch, now, it is possible to by above NFC induction installation 90 senses.Now, NFC induction installation 90 can read NFC The information of sensor label 100, and generate corresponding according to the information of this NFC sensor label 100 Electrical signal of reaction.When controller 30 receives this induced signal when, can be according to this Induced signal judges that the switch of chopper is in the state of connection.And when the switch of chopper is jumped Lock, i.e. NFC sensor label 100 is allocated to (be likely due to circuit protection along with switch together Reason automatic trip, it is also possible to stirred by artificial) lower section, now NFC sensing dress Put 90 and cannot sense NFC sensor label 100 again, the most just cannot read NFC sense again Answering the information in label 100, controller is according to the result read, it is judged that the Ka Guan of chopper It is off.
